Man down: Polanco helped off field with "right knee strain"

Maybe our good luck with injuries is running out.

While trying to field a pop up near the pitching mound during today's Grapefruit League game against the Pirates, Placido Polanco went down in a heap and had to be helped off by a pair of trainers.  The Phillies are calling it a "right knee strain" for now (hat tip to Matt Gelb, among others), and we'll presumably have to wait and see what an MRI says before we know more.
